acrylic a kind of plastic used to make yarns, paint, and many other things.
beach ball a large, air-filled ball of brightly colored plastic, usually used for games played in or near the water.
bead a small, round object made of material such as glass, wood, or plastic. A bead has a small hole through its center so it can be put on a string to make necklaces or to decorate clothing. [1/3 definitions]
block a small cube or other three-dimensional shape made out of wood or plastic and used as a child's building toy. [1/9 definitions]
bottle a container with a narrow neck and no handle used to hold or pour liquids. A bottle is usually made of glass or plastic. [1/3 definitions]
camphor a white substance with a very strong smell that is taken from the camphor tree. A form of camphor can also be made by people. Camphor is used in making some kinds of medicine and plastic.
card1 a small piece of cardboard, plastic, or thick paper printed with information about a person. A card is used to identify the person whose name is on it. [1/4 definitions]
carton a box made of thick paper or of plastic made to hold one particular type of product.
celluloid a plastic that burns easily. Celluloid is used for motion picture film.
clothespin a clip or forked peg of wood or plastic, used to hold clothes on a line for drying.
comb a thin piece of plastic or other material that has teeth along one side. It is used to smooth, arrange, or hold hair in place. [1/5 definitions]
contact lens a thin, plastic lens that is worn on the eyeball to correct vision or change the color of the eyes.
disc2 a thin, round plate used to record data entered on a computer. Disks are often contained within a plastic case. [1/3 definitions]
dustpan a flat pan shaped like a small shovel with an attached handle. It is usually made of metal or plastic. A dustpan is used for gathering up dust or dirt while sweeping with a broom.
eyedropper a small glass or plastic tube used to apply drops of medicine, especially to the eyes.
file2 a long, thin steel tool with ridges on its surface. A file is used to shape, smooth, or grind down wood, metal, plastic, or other hard material. [1/2 definitions]
floppy disk a thin plastic disk with a special coating, on which computer information can be stored; diskette.
Frisbee a trade name for a thin plastic disc that is thrown and caught in outdoor games.
garbage can a large, strong container made of metal or plastic used for holding things that are to be thrown away.
hanger a frame with a hook at the top, made of wire, wood, or plastic, and shaped so that one may hang clothes over it. [1/2 definitions]
hard hat a strong hat made of hard plastic. It protects the heads of people who work in dangerous places such as mines or construction areas.
